In this issue of Archways, we hope you will find inspiration in our cover subject, Dorothy Day – a laywoman of extraordinary talent, energy and compassion who became a Catholic at age 30 and went on to co-found the Catholic Worker movement during the Great Depression. Over the next five decades, her works of mercy and devotion to the poor and oppressed reached around the world. The archdiocese is now promoting her cause for sainthood.
